引言:随着去中心化钱包与轻钱包在个人与企业级场景的广泛应用,tpwallet与麦子钱包代表的产品在功能与安全设计上各有侧重。本文围绕防重放攻击、全球化创新应用、专业研判、安全性与数据保护等维度,提出研判结论与可落地建议。
一、防重放攻击(Replay Attack)的技术对策
1. 时间戳与生存期:在交易签名结构中加入严格的时间戳与有效期字段,结合链上/链下校验逻辑拒绝过期签名。客户端应支持本地时间校准与NTP回退策略以减少误判。
2. 非重复值(nonce)机制:为每个地址或会话维持全局/链上递增nonce,或基于随机挑战-响应的会话nonce,确保同一签名不能在不同上下文重复使用。
3. 会话绑定签名:将会话ID(或链ID、合约地址)纳入签名原文,防止跨链或跨合约重放。对于跨链桥接场景,必须在桥合约中验证来源链与交易语境。

4. 网络层防护:采用双向TLS、短时证书与DTLS用于移动网络环境,减少中间人重放风险。对重要操作启用一次性令牌(OTP)或多因素签名确认。
二、全球化创新应用场景
1. 跨境支付与法币通道:集成多家合规的法币通道(合规的支付网关、合规受托人),提供本地化入金/出金体验并支持多币种、自动汇率路由。
2. 本地化合规与KYC弹性:采用“合规适配器”架构,根据用户所在司法辖区加载不同KYC/AML策略与隐私保护策略,兼顾合规与用户隐私。
3. 模块化金融服务:钱包作为开放平台,支持钱包内借贷、保险、NFT交易等模块化插件,利用安全沙箱隔离第三方插件权限。

4. 企业级钱包与多签:提供企业托管、多层审批与硬件签名集成,适配不同国家法律对商业托管的要求。
三、专业研判报告(要点式)
- 威胁面:签名泄露、重放、社工程、跨链桥oracle被攻破、私钥备份泄漏。
- 脆弱性优先级:1) 私钥管理与恢复流程 2) 跨链消息不可预测性 3) 智能合约升级逻辑(中心化后门) 4) API/SDK注入攻击。
- 风险减缓措施:硬件密钥保护(HSM或TEE)、最小权限SDK、定期安全审计与模糊测试、保险与应急响应计划。
四、数字化经济前景与钱包的角色
钱包不再只是签名工具,而是价值流动的用户入口。未来三到五年可见趋势:
- 微支付与流量经济化:低费率链上微支付、流媒体与IoT计费将推动钱包作为计费节点。
- 数字身份与凭证:钱包承载可验证凭证(VC)与数字身份,降低信任成本。
- CBDC与商业整合:钱包需兼容央行数字货币接口并与现有金融系统互操作。
五、智能合约安全要点
1. 合约设计原则:最小权限、不可变数据与清晰的停止开关(circuit breaker)。避免信任外部不可信数据为决定性条件。
2. 安全开发生命周期:形式化验证、单元与集成测试、开源审计、多家安全厂商联合测评。
3. 升级模式谨慎使用:若采用代理模式(proxy),需限制升级权限并记录治理链路。引入时间锁与多签作为升级二次确认。
4. 预言机与外部依赖:采用分布式预言机、经济激励与数据可争议解决流程,降低单点操纵风险。
六、实时数据保护与隐私保障
1. 端到端加密:通信层、存储层均应加密。私钥绝不应在服务器端明文存在,恢复种子经加密保存在用户掌控的设备或受托HSM中。
2. 最小化数据收集:仅保存合规所需数据,使用可选的本地KYC缓存与分布式证明减少中心化信息库。
3. 实时监控与异常检测:在保留隐私的前提下部署行为分析模型(差分隐私或联邦学习)以检测异常签名、流量模式与账号盗用。
4. 法律与合规对接:支持法域内合规披露路径(受法院或监管要求时的可证明透明度),并保留技术手段证明对用户隐私的最小侵入性。
结论与建议:
对于tpwallet与麦子钱包,建议统一采用强非重复签名机制、模块化合规适配器、硬件级私钥保护与多重审计流程;在全球化拓展时平衡本地合规与用户体验;在智能合约与跨链设计上优先稳定可验证的方案;并通过联邦学习、差分隐私等技术实现实时监控与数据保护的兼容。建立完整的应急响应、保险与透明度报告机制,将有助于在日益竞争的数字化经济中建立长期信任与可持续增长。
评论
NovaUser
很全面的分析,尤其是关于重放攻击和nonce的实践建议很实用。
小明
希望能看到具体实现样例或SDK推荐,便于工程落地。
CryptoGuru
对智能合约升级风险的提醒非常到位,时间锁+多签是必须的。
林夕
赞同差分隐私与联邦学习用于实时监控,兼顾安全与隐私是关键。